Abstract
A multicamera imaging-based bar code reader 10 for imaging a target bar code 30 on a target object 32 features: a housing 20 supporting a plurality of transparent windows H, V and defining an interior region, an imaging system including a plurality of camera assemblies C1-C5 coupled to an image processing system, each camera assembly of the plurality of camera assemblies being positioned within the housing interior. Each camera assembly includes a sensor array. One or more light reflecting fold mirrors M1-M14 define a camera assembly field of view positioned with respect to said light source and the sensor array at locations along a light path to transmit light from light source to the field of view and transmit light that bounces from a target in the field of view back along said light path to the image capture sensor array.

9. A method for imaging a target bar code comprising:
-
providing a housing having one or more transparent windows that define a region for movement and for positioning of an object having a bar code; positioning a camera having a sensor array within the housing for imaging bar codes on objects outside the housing; illuminating a region outside the housing by activating a light source in said housing positioned in close proximity to the sensor array of said camera and deflecting light from the light source off from one or more fold mirrors positioned between the source and the one or more transparent windows to baffle light emitted from the source from reaching an illumination field of view; imaging a target object having a target bar code in a position essentially only within the illumination field of view; interpreting images from the camera to determine a bar code; wherein there are multiple cameras and each camera has associated with it multiple mirrors defining a corresponding fields of view; and wherein the light source is a light emitting diode and shielding is provided along a portion of the light path between the light emitting diode and a first of said one or more fold mirrors. - View Dependent Claims (10, 11)
